VP, Architecture & Data Engineer - Horizon Media

Overview
We are seeking an expert-level Technical Data Engineer to architect and implement our modern data stack at Horizon Media. This role will be responsible for designing, building, and optimizing our data pipelines using Snowflake, dbt, and Fivetran, while ensuring data quality, scalability, and business value. The ideal candidate will possess deep technical expertise and hands-on experience with these technologies to drive our data transformation init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

  1. Architect and implement advanced data pipelines using dbt, Fivetran, and Snowflake to support analytics, reporting, and machine learning initiatives
  2. Design and develop complex data models in dbt, implementing best practices for modularity, testing, and documentation
  3. Configure and optimize Fivetran connectors for diverse data sources, ensuring efficient and reliable data ingestion
  4. Implement sophisticated data transformation logic using Snowflake's native capabilities and dbt macros
  5. Develop and maintain CI/CD pipelines for dbt projects, ensuring code quality through automated testing and deployment
  6. Optimize query performance and resource utilization in Snowflake through careful warehouse sizing, materialization strategies, and query tuning
  7. Implement data quality checks and monitoring across the entire data pipeline
  8. Design and implement data versioning strategies to support multiple environments and enable seamless rollbacks
  9. Collaborate with data analysts, data scientists, and business stakeholders to translate business requirements into technical specifications
  10. Provide technical leadership and mentorship to junior data engineers on best practices and design patterns

Qualifications

  1. 5+ years of hands-on experience as a data engineer with at least 3 years of deep expertise in dbt, Fivetran, and Snowflake
  2. Advanced knowledge of SQL, including complex query optimization and performance tuning in Snowflake
  3. Proven experience designing and implementing large-scale dbt projects, including custom macros, packages, and testing frameworks
  4. Extensive experience configuring and troubleshooting Fivetran connectors for various data sources
  5. Strong understanding of data modeling concepts (dimensional modeling, data vault, etc.) and their implementation in dbt
  6. Experience with version control systems (Git) and CI/CD pipelines for data engineering workflows
  7. Familiarity with Python or other programming languages for data processing and automation
  8. Experience with data quality frameworks and implementation of testing strategies
  9. Knowledge of cloud infrastructure (AWS preferred) and how it integrates with the modern data stack
  10. Experience in media, advertising, or related industries preferred

Technical Skills

  1. dbt: Advanced modeling, custom macros, packages, documentation, testing frameworks
  2. Fivetran: Connector configuration, troubleshooting, custom transformations, API integration
  3. Snowflake: Performance optimization, resource management, security configuration, stored procedures
  4. SQL: Advanced query writing, performance tuning, window functions, optimization techniques
  5. Git: Branch management, code review processes, collaborative development
  6. CI/CD: Implementing automated testing and deployment for data pipelines
  7. Python: Data processing, automation, custom connectors (beneficial)
  8. AWS: S3, Lambda, Glue, and other data-related services (beneficial)
